Kerala Govt would not impose restrictions on media:Pinarai
Kochi | Sunday, Nov 1 2009 IST
 

CPI(M State Secretary Pinarayi Vijayan today said the Kerala Government would not impose restrictions on media.

Speaking in a Meet the Press programme organised by Ernakulam Press Club, Mr Vijayan said controlling the media was not an agenda of the Left Democratic Front(LDF) Government.

A decision to release government-related informations only through Public Relations Department(PRD) was to ensure genuine information to Media and this should not be construed as censorship on the Fourth Estate, he added.

The CPI(M) leader said people would vote for the LDF in the ensuing Assembly byepolls to the State. He alleged the Centre was trying to strengthen its privatisation policy and many profit-making establishments would be sold out soon.

He would comment about 'Love Jihad' issue following a detailed study on the issue, he said.
